Understanding Your Financing Options

When facing the cost of major restorative work, such as dental implants or cosmetic dentistry, patients in Alberta typically look for three things: low interest rates, flexible terms, and ease of approval. Traditional credit cards often carry high interest rates that can exceed 20%, making them a costly choice for long-term payment plans. Specialized dental financing products bridge this gap by offering promotional periods with zero interest or lower rates specifically for healthcare expenses.

Two dominant players in the Canadian market are PayBright (now rebranded as Clearpay in many contexts but often still referred to by its legacy name in dental offices) and Dentalcard. While both serve the same fundamental purpose, their structures differ significantly. PayBright focuses on short-term, interest-free installment plans, while Dentalcard offers a revolving credit line similar to a credit card but with dental-specific benefits.

PayBright (Clearpay) Analysis

PayBright, which has been acquired by Clearpay, has revolutionized how patients pay for mid-range dental procedures. It is particularly popular for services like Invisalign, teeth whitening, and fillings. The core value proposition is simplicity and speed.

How It Works

PayBright operates on a "buy now, pay later" model. Instead of paying the full amount upfront, you split the cost into four equal installments. The first payment is made at the time of service, and the remaining three are automatically charged every two weeks. This structure eliminates interest charges entirely if payments are made on time.

Pros and Cons

The primary advantage of PayBright is the lack of interest. For a procedure costing $1,000, you pay exactly $1,000 over two months. This is ideal for patients who have steady cash flow but need to smooth out their monthly expenses. Additionally, the approval process is instant and does not typically involve a hard credit check, which protects your credit score.

However, PayBright has limitations. It is generally capped at lower transaction amounts, often up to $2,000 or $3,000 depending on the merchant and your credit history. This makes it unsuitable for major restorative work like full-mouth reconstructions or multiple implants, which can easily exceed $10,000. Furthermore, late fees can be steep, so missing a payment can quickly negate the benefit of interest-free financing.

Dentalcard Review

Dentalcard is a specialized line of credit designed exclusively for dental, vision, and hearing care. It is widely accepted across Canada, including in Calgary, and is often the go-to solution for high-cost procedures. Unlike PayBright, Dentalcard functions more like a traditional credit card but with significant perks tailored to healthcare.

Key Features

Dentalcard offers a revolving credit line, meaning you can use it for multiple procedures over time. One of its most attractive features is the promotional financing options. Patients can often qualify for 12 to 24 months of no-interest financing on major procedures. This allows for manageable monthly payments without the burden of accumulating interest.

Pros and Cons

The biggest advantage of Dentalcard is its capacity. It can handle large bills that PayBright cannot. For example, a complex restorative dentistry project costing $8,000 can be spread over two years with low monthly payments. It also offers a 10% discount on dental care at participating offices, which can provide immediate savings.

On the downside, Dentalcard requires a credit application and a hard inquiry, which may temporarily lower your credit score. If you do not qualify for the promotional zero-interest period, the standard interest rate can be high. It is crucial to read the fine print and ensure you can pay off the balance within the promotional window to avoid significant interest charges.

Which is better for a $5,000 implant procedure?

For a $5,000 procedure, Dentalcard is generally the better option. PayBright typically has a transaction limit that may not cover the full cost of implants. Dentalcard offers longer repayment terms and potential interest-free periods, making monthly payments more manageable.

Will applying for Dentalcard hurt my credit score?

Applying for Dentalcard involves a hard credit inquiry, which can temporarily lower your credit score by a few points. However, responsible use of the card can help build your credit history over time. PayBright, on the other hand, usually performs a soft check that does not impact your score.

Can I use both PayBright and Dentalcard?

Yes, you can use both depending on the procedure. You might use PayBright for a smaller, immediate need like a cleaning or filling, and Dentalcard for a larger, long-term project like orthodontics. It is important to manage both accounts responsibly to avoid debt accumulation.

Are there any hidden fees with these financing options?

PayBright charges late fees if payments are missed, but no interest if paid on time. Dentalcard may charge annual fees or interest if the promotional period is not paid off in full. Always review the terms and conditions provided by the financing company before signing.
